SFBS ServisFirst Bancshares dividend history, payout ratio & dates

ServisFirst Bancshares's last cash dividend of $0.3 per share was issued to shareholders on record before Oct 1, 2024. At an annualized rate of $1.2 per share, the stock yields 1.5%.

What is ServisFirst Bancshares current dividend yield

ServisFirst Bancshares's dividend yield of 1.5% is lower than the Financial Services sector, the industry and its peers average. In comparison with the Financial Services sector average of 2.91%, ServisFirst Bancshares's dividend yield is 48% lower. Historically SFBS's dividend yield has averaged at 1.6% in the last 5 years, which is higher than the current one.

Dividend history

What is SFBS dividend payout history and dates

ServisFirst Bancshares has been paying dividends for the last ten years. According to our records SFBS has distributed four quarterly dividends in the past year. The annualized dividend per share has increased by 7% for the last twelve months. However with the stock price up by 52% from a year ago, the dividend yield has decreased by 30%.

ServisFirst Bancshares dividend payout ratio

What is ServisFirst Bancshares dividend payout ratio compared to the sector

Payout ratio

ServisFirst Bancshares's payout ratio of 33.1% is below the Financial Services sector, the industry and its peers average. Compared to its Financial Services sector average of 43.3%, ServisFirst Bancshares's payout ratio is 24% lower.
